Output 21c64d80720cf6bc265805166559f2ebeeac7358b5f964a5d6155a7e59e94e52:19

value
1099
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31ab08cc661adc3175fa977ae95ed7a43e3b9176aaefca7a32ba4157806e80bf
address
bc1pxx4s3nrxrtwrza06jaawjhkh5slrhytk4thu573jhfq40qrwszlsg2plf6
transaction
21c64d80720cf6bc265805166559f2ebeeac7358b5f964a5d6155a7e59e94e52
spent
true